This publication is the curriculum guide for a 720-hour open-entry, open-exit program of education for female prisoners at the Eddie Warrior Correctional Center (EWCC) in Oklahoma, which has increased the average number of EWCC inmates awarded General Educational Development (GED) certificates from 32 to about 200. The guide begins with an explanation of how students are assigned either a Laubach tutor or a computer laboratory class, based on their tested reading ability. Next are descriptions of instruction provided at six tables to which students rotate to study vocabulary, language expression, reading comprehension, language mechanics, mathematics concepts, and mathematics computation. Computer reinforcement is described next. The guide concludes with lists of what students need to know to pass national tests. (KC)
